Новый блокнотик.ру (Будни)
BM
[info]xenru
Сегодня позвонил очередной рекламный агент на телефон службы доставки воды в Днепропетровске. Представился из службы webbloknot.ком (специально чтобы парсер не сделал случайно ссылкой), с горем пополам прислал приглашение. Проект достаточно близкая копия UAProm.net'а, хотя по телефону мне сказали, что "не знаем о таком проекте".

За эти дни мы успели только сделать нашу страничку на нем и еще засунули несколько объявлений на нескольких досках. Причем опубликовалось оно только на двух из трех, поскольку на Gorod'е похоже объявления "паламалися, а пачинить некаму". Все думаю может у них когда-нть логи переполнятся и сайт не будет отвечать или обнаружится, что индексы на какие-то поля не стоят, а базада переполнилась. Уже сейчас часто страницы форума невозможно посмотреть. Ну да ладно о главном городском портале можно отдельный пост сделать.

В общем с вероятностью 33% о нас узнали именно с УАПрома. Либо кто-то читает мой блог, во что я слабо верю.

Вот мои мысли почему блокнотиком нельзя пользоваться в текущий момент:

Первое, у "портала" посещаемость не публикуется, скорее всего она просто очень низка чтобы о ней можно было бы говорить.

Второе, возможно мне было бы интересно зарегистрироваться в каталоге хотя бы ради одной лишней внешней ссылки, но увы это предоставляете платно, а при нулевой посещаемости платить за ссылку 100 гривен в месяц плюс оплата сразу за год... очень дорого. Я бы вообще сначала оценил возможную отдачу от проекта, а только потом пытался вылезти на более высокие позиции.

Третье, название вообще ни о чем не говорит. Для знающих ассоциируется в Блокнотиком заспамившим когда-то весь рунет, для незнающих ничего не скажет. Какой-то нахрен уебблокнотик в зоне ком. УАПром тоже не ахти, но хотя бы по телефону диктовать меньше букв.

Четвертое, сказали, что не знаете об http://uaprom.net/. Очень жаль, но тогда в интернете рано делать сайты, надо хотя бы изучить рынок.

Пятое, как авторы сайта планируют работать с украинскими компаниями если ваш сайт в кодировке (#$%#^$$@%^) Win-1251? Как я смогу совмещать тексты на разных языках на одной странице? Если вдруг такое случится. Даже сейчас не получится записать названия, например, очистительного оборудования.

Улыбало
BM
[info]xenru
How we did it
How we did it, originally uploaded by murkotik.

Давненько я не постил в блог свое морда.


Новый SF.net
BM
[info]xenru
Такая пусечка по сравнению с тем что было. Ня-ня-ня!

New SF.net design


Может быть даже захочется вспомнить учетную запись. Sf.net
Tags: , , , ,

Миф об эффективности спама
BM
[info]xenru
Написал небольшую статью об эффективности спама по сравнению с контекстной рекламой, так и назвал "Миф об эффективности спама".

Статья опубликована на сайте Медиавируса потому, что там ей более правильное место и с точки зрения контента и важности для самого ресурса.

В статье сравнивается стоимость рассылки спама по сравнению со стоимостью размещения контекстной рекламы.

Служба доставки воды
BM
[info]xenru
Не сидится на месте :)

Мы с одним знакомым решили запустить проект службы доставки воды в Днепропетровске www.Sweetwater.dp.ua.

Исходные данные таковы:

- Есть человек у которого в аптеке стоит хорошее очистительное оборудование, к нему постоянно приезжает санэпидемстанции и прочие проверяльщики
- Есть человек который умеет продвигать проекты в интернете
- и есть не шибко-то и конкурентный рынок (в интернете) воды

Точнее конкуренция есть и существуют даже интересные проекты, но по сравнению с тем что творится в Москве тут пустыня. Но и объем рынка меньше. Но и трудностей не боимся, к тому же тот кто не пробует так и не узнает возможен успех или нет.

По сути сегодня второй день работы, потому, что вчера мы купили номер телефона и запустил рекламу в AdWords. Этот пост мне нужен самому для отсчета времени после начала работы и оценки эффективности применяемых средств раскрутки, а так же рассказать немного о реалиях местного бизнеса.

И если сегодня первая точка отсчета, то это не значит что все началось сегодня же :) Сеть аптек существует с 98 года, бизнесом по продаже очищенной воды начали заниматься почти два года назад. До текущего момента это была продажа посетителям в свою тару.

Несколько месяцев назад знакомый заикнулся, что у него в общем-то есть такой товар, на что я заметил, что сейчас в Днепропетровске стоимость первых мест по очень большому количеству запросов просто минимальна. Да и привел в качестве примера результаты которых мы смогли добиться для службы доставки суши и пиццы. На что он предложил мне заняться маркетингом, а его основная часть, решили попробовать.

Провел анализ интернет ресурсов, по результатам принял решение все же заниматься. Дело начало крутиться: зарегистрировал домен, нарисовал логотип, заказал написание текстов знакомой журналистке и состряпал самостоятельно часть текстов. Начали искать поставщиков оборудования и анализировать цены.

Параллельно начали анализ местного рынка и собирать опыт о мировой практике. Пока получили хорошее представление о рынке доставки воды в Израиле и берем его в качестве эталона и большой цели.

Что же мы имеем за два дня? Не так уж и много, но и не пусто. Несколько звонков уже было, но это пока еще люди которые хотят нам продать какие-то услуги или партнерство. Первый был через два часа после начала публикации объявления через Google AdWords.

Я пока внимательно изучаю каждый полученный звонок и накапливаю опыт, странный местный маркетинг тоже интересен и в практическом плане и "медицинской" точки зрения.

Путь в тысячу ли

Первое что я сам себе постоянно говорю: "Нельзя недооценивать конкурентов, клиентов и рынок". Часто многих вещей нет на рынке только потому, что они никому не нужны и мнимые "промахи" конкурентов являются всего навсего коммерческой целесообразностью. И клиенты не готовы доплачивать лишние деньги за навязчивый сервис. С другой стороны у меня в крови умение быть не таким как все.

Какие проблемы показало нам исследование служб доставки:

- Отсутствие возможности заказать воду в любое удобное время. Это то что мы собираемся решить в первую очередь. Клиент должен иметь возможность заказать воду не только с 10 до 12 в рабочие дни. При нынешних объемах заказа мы физически не можем принимать заказы круглосуточно, но это временная мера.
- Жлобские накрутки на оборудовании. Самая простая помпа не может стоить 60 гривен. Пока с нашими объемами мы будем продавать помпу по цене 48 гривен то есть по той цене которой берем у поставщика. Как только выйдем на нормальные объемы будем добиваться максимальных скидок или будем ввозить сами
- Жлобские цены на баллоны. По моему они вообще должны стоить копейки, но пока они у нас 45 гривен.
- Мы следим за качеством, смена фильтров происходит строго по требованиям технологии, а раз в квартал приезжает регулярная проверка.

Остальное не всегда видно клиенту, но мы анализируем опыт работы с каждым клиентом и следим за его объемами потребления воды чтобы в будущем сделать возможность удобной доставки в зависимости от планируемого исчерпания ценного ресурса.

В планах расширение спектра товаров которые мы будем предлагать доставлять вместе с водой. Это будет чай, кофе, сливки и другие сопутствующие товары.

Замеры

Для подведения итогов. На сегодняшний день сайт www.sweetwater.dp.ua был добавлен в адурилки и не появляется в результатах поиска ни по одному запросу (кроме названия домена в Яндексе).

Первый шаг сделан.

Ускоряя Python через JavaScript
BM
[info]xenru
На Advogado.org висит прикольная статья "pyv8: python v8 bindings and a python-javascript compiler". Суть проекта pyv8 заключается в том, что был взят python-javascript компилятор из pyjamas которому были допилены биндинги от v8 к python'у. v8 очень крутой проект и дело проканало таким образом, что дало прирост производительности в 10 раз.

В качестве сноски указывается, что если вы готовы к таким извратам, то cython дает прирост производительности уже в 100 раз на той же задаче.

Казалось бы, ну и что. Мало ли, что там творится в самом быстром браузере. Суть в том, что биндинги дают возможность работать с библиотеками которые изначально были написаны на С. То есть графические тулкиты продолжают жить.

Не буду жадничать, прочитайте статью и комментарии, а то анонс получился уже почти такой же как и сама статья :)

На сладкое ссылка на статью Орлова о Pyjamas.

Майкл Джексон
BM
[info]xenru
R.I.P.

Очень грустно, великий человек.

Erlang от O'Reilly
BM
[info]xenru
На Safari Online доступна книга Erlang от O'Reilly Media которая будет выпущена только завтра — June 26, 2009.



Содержание книги понемногу обо всем. Начиная от азов языка и введение в разнородные прикладные задачи, например есть GUI программирование, взаимодействие с Java, OTP, Mnesia.

С удовольствием прочитаю ее полностью.

Теперь есть две книжки, первая была опубликована в 2007 Pragmatic Programming Erlang.

CSS спрайты
BM
[info]xenru
В принципе этот пост ставит жирную точку в истории использования техники монолитных CSS спрайтов (одна картинка для всего декора сайта). Вот краткий перечень пунктов которые должны были быть в статье, чтобы не читать простынку и комменты:

- Сложность верстки и структуры документа, трудоемкость сильно увеличивается
- Огромные требования к памяти. Все эти пустые места между ценными спрайтами занимают кучу места в памяти. X*Y*4 (альфа канал в PNG не забываем) могут спокойно выжрать десятки мегабайт
- Гораздо сложнее поддержка, если понадобится заменить одну иконку, то придется править огромную картинку еще раз.

Оправданно правильное использование на сайте Империи сделал Паша. Нудыкйб, он же профи :)

И Google Chrome теперь с разработчиками
BM
[info]xenru
WebKit'овый дебагер и профайлер теперь с нами в Google Chrome. По сравнению с тем который в Safari не хватает смотрелки баз данных, но поскольку в живую подержать в руках пока не получилось, то сказать нечего. Судите по сриншоту:



Шаг правильный и ожидаемый, но не знаю что подвигло на его реализацию. Есть подозрение, что таблица сравнения браузеров от дурных пиарщиков Microsoft'а наделавшая много смеха. Потому, что view-source: свой и очень хороший. Safari, например, такого очень не хватает. Впрочем на тикеты подписан не был, свечку не держал.

Жаль, что у Chrome под Mac не работает Flash. А то может быть и пересел бы :)

Shii - The Wii for Women
BM
[info]xenru

Мне тоже кажется, что для приставки для девушек — это большая глубокая незанятая ниша.

Группа "Война" опять отличилась
BM
[info]xenru
Позор, это просто ужас какой-то. Сраное современное искусство опять позволяет себе такие выходки. Группа "Война" опять устроила отвратительный перформанс в здании суда! Уважаемые френды копируйте и публикуйте ссылку на этот кошмар, такого позволять просто невозможно. Полное безобразие и блядство!

Первое письмо в Gmail
BM
[info]xenru
Что-то интерфейс всех гугловских служб уж очень тормозит уже пару недель. Безусловно причина в плохом качестве работы Голден Телекома в Днепре. Поэтому пришлось пересесть на Mail.app. Функция скролла показала, что мое первое письмо в почте датируется 30 сентября 2004 года. В этом году будет 5 лет как я люблю пользоваться почтой.

Лето
BM
[info]xenru
Наконец-то стало по летнему тепло. Больше 30 это уже хорошо, больше 35 — вообще прекрасно. Вместе с толпой фотографов съездили на Хортицу, оказалось неожиданно чистое место с вменяемым количеством посторонних людей. Даже удалось покупаться в Днепре, заодно открыл сезон. К сожалению немного обгорела шея и кончики ушей, не люблю загорать и портить здоровье солнцем, но раз уж так получилось, то немного пострадаю.

Оказывается там очень много гадюк, плюс каменистый берег. Возможно это и бережет остров от наплыва диких городских жителей.

Больше одного раза на острове бывать не имеет смысла, смотреть на бутафорский замок еще тот прикол украинского дибилизма. Под Вильнюсом за день до отъезда ходил в ресторан в древнем стиле. По аутентичности даст 100 очков "мазанкам" которым даже в окна не посмотреть. Как на музейное место любо дорого посмотреть и квас можно купить. А тут даже лотошники с водой скрылись, плюс за вход доллар (6 гривен) и доллар за фотографирование.



Юля наверное выложит фотки с поездки, так что можно будет сравнить.

Летнее настроение это хорошо.

2 часа простоя за 40 лет
BM
[info]xenru
Все же каким-то образом наскочил на доклад Саши на HL++




Интересный доклад, но вторая половина вопросы зала. Сложно судить по одному докладу о всей конференции, но вынужден предупредить что половина вопросов тупые и от тупых людей. Небольшая частично хорошие и правильные. Типо предупреждение.

Bonus Улучшенная версия графика с первого слайда: YAWS vs MochiWeb vs Nginx. Что-то венерическое в этом есть.

P.S. Счастлив, что ничего нового не услышал, значит персональные изыскания не прошли даром и все ценное уже знал. Получить подтверждение своим знаниям очень важно.

Legend of the Seeker второй сезон
BM
[info]xenru
Рейтинги были достаточно хороши чтобы продолжить съемку сериала, но пока нет дополнительной информации.

Кто будет вместо Рала не известно, по книге (не спойля) Ричард Рал Сайфер призвал кого-то более ужасного. Только я не знаю кого.

Два дня жизни одной ссылко
BM
[info]xenru
Дала/не дала

Я сломал интернет
BM
[info]xenru
Угораздило же.

9000 запросов в секунду
BM
[info]xenru
Надо как-то по дзенски перефразировать, что когда начинаешь проверять очевидные вещи, то великое множество открытий обнаруживаешь.

Сейчас пишу один проект в котором мне требуется обрабатывать миллионы запросов в сутки, а может быть и в час. Всегда думал, что ab именно так утилита с помощью которой проверяется нагрузка на сервера. Невод свой забрасывал вот такой непритязательной командой:
loremaster:~ xen$ ab -n 10000 -c 100 http://127.0.0.1/

Умер nginx, умер обычный django (для теста), erlang сервер не умер. Но характер загрузок ядра получился очень некрасивый и неприятный (дело было на ноуте MacBook Intell), самый длинный запрос залетел аж на 19 секунд, при этом какое-то мгновение оба ядра заняты на 100% потом тишина, потом опять. Главное что сервера на erlang'е неумирают, но и то ладно.

Пришлось невод заменить на
loremaster:~ xen$ ab -n 10000 -c 10 http://127.0.0.1/

С 3й попытки django/python прошел проверку, то есть сервер вылетает случайным образом. nginx тоже кое как дошел до финиша, erlang справился без кряхтения.

Раз в статье речь про статистику, то вот сравнение. Хотя для меня в нем цели как таковой не было. Приложение пока не написано.

Server Software:        nginx/0.6.32
Server Hostname:        127.0.0.1
Server Port:            80

Document Path:          /
Document Length:        151 bytes

Concurrency Level:      10
Time taken for tests:   2.289 seconds
Complete requests:      10000
Failed requests:        0
Write errors:           0
Total transferred:      3620000 bytes
HTML transferred:       1510000 bytes
Requests per second:    4368.58 [#/sec] (mean)
Time per request:       2.289 [ms] (mean)
Time per request:       0.229 [ms] (mean, across all concurrent requests)
Transfer rate:          1544.36 [Kbytes/sec] received
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Server Software:        MochiWeb/1.0
Server Hostname:        127.0.0.1
Server Port:            8000

Document Path:          /
Document Length:        88 bytes

Concurrency Level:      10
Time taken for tests:   6.935 seconds
Complete requests:      10000
Failed requests:        0
Write errors:           0
Total transferred:      2900580 bytes
HTML transferred:       880176 bytes
Requests per second:    1441.88 [#/sec] (mean)
Time per request:       6.935 [ms] (mean)
Time per request:       0.694 [ms] (mean, across all concurrent requests)
Transfer rate:          408.43 [Kbytes/sec] received

При прочих равных лучше использовать сервера на erlang'е, скорость отличная и надежность офигительная.

Спам подзамочников в ЖаЖе
BM
[info]xenru
Достал спам гандонов из garin-studio.ru. Сегодня опять несколько ботов подписалось на мой дневник. Поведение общее, тихо подписываются в друзья, все записи под-замочные, цитируют отрывки то ли из рассказов, то ли из других журналов.

Один-два в неделю еще куда не шло, но по 4-5 в день уже просто неприлично. Пошел посмотреть на одного такого elkuvere.livejournal.com. В исходном коде страницы обнаружился следующий код:

<a href="http://elkuvere.livejournal.com/10933.html" class="subj-link"> - <em>Я болен</em></a></span> <img src="http://l-stat.livejournal.com/img/icon_protected.gif" title="" alt="[protected post]" height="15" width="14" /></h3><p><img src="http://fun.it-s-me.ru/px6384.gif"><p>События последних дней окончательно подорвали мое здоровье и я слег....

Пошел проверить кому принадлежит домен it-s-me.ru, хуиз показал:
по данным WHOIS.RIPN.NET:

% By submitting a query to RIPN's Whois Service
% you agree to abide by the following terms of use:
% http://www.ripn.net/about/servpol.html#3.2 (in Russian) 
% http://www.ripn.net/about/en/servpol.html#3.2 (in English).

domain:     IT-S-ME.RU
type:       CORPORATE
nserver:    ns1.q0.ru.
nserver:    ns2.q0.ru.
nserver:    ns3.q0.ru.
state:      REGISTERED, DELEGATED
org:        LTD "Garin Studio"
phone:      +7 499 1582479
fax-no:     +7 499 1582479
e-mail:     info@garin-studio.ru
registrar:  CENTROHOST-REG-RIPN
created:    2008.02.13
paid-till:  2010.02.13
source:     TC-RIPN


Предлагаю флешмоб тем кто сейчас в Москве. Собираете трехлитровую банку собачьего говна и приносите в закрытом виде по адресу: 125363, Москва, ул. Балтийская, дом 5, 4 этаж. Как пройти можно узнать по телефону/факсу: +7 (495) 223-32-57. Приходить можно в любой день, в нерабочие оставлять у здания.

Home